Meadow view, Chertsey, KT16 8QH

Meadow view is a street located in Chertsey, with a postcode of KT16 8QH. There have been 26 property transactions in this postcode since 1995, with 12 unique properties. The most common property type in this street is terrace. The most recent sale was on Thursday, 6 July 2023 at 16 Meadow view which sold for £700000. The average broadband download speed is 263.80 mbps. There are 10 nearby train stations, 8 nearby bus stops and 8 nearby schools. KT16 8QH postcode was first in introduced in February 2003. KT16 8QH is located within the Slough and Heathrow Travel To Work Area. NHS Services in this postcode are provided by the Surrey Primary Care Trust. The 2011 Census Output Area for this postcode is classified as 'Urbanites, Ageing urban living, Self-sufficient retirement'. KT16 8QH has an Index of Multiple Deprivation of 27053.

Deprivation Index

The Index of Multiple Deprivation (IMD) is a UK measure that ranks areas based on multiple indicators of deprivation such as income, employment, health, education, housing, crime, and access to services. The IMD informs decisions and helps allocate resources to reduce poverty and improve life chances.
